RV Toaster

Great place for relaxing view of the Ohio River. All seating is outdoors so no a/c but there is shade from umbrellas and roof coverings. Food is served on paper or aluminum with plastic utensils. Everything is disposable if the environment is a concern of yours. Staff is friendly. Menu has something for everyone. Ample parking. Can get crowded on weekends. Plan to eat dinner early or you may wait an hour plus to be seated. The live music will entertain you while waiting but call to confirm or check their website. Worth trying.
